35 High Street is a one-bedroom mid-terrace house in Chrishall, Royston, Royston (SG8 8RN). It has a recorded floor area of 58 m² (around 624 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band B. Tenure is freehold. The latest certificate (May 2012)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would lift it to A (score 98),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ity. The latest certificate is from May 2012,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Period features are noted in the property record.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 6.5%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£289,000 sits 53.3% above the 2014 sale of £188,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£302/sq ft) was about 16.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 58 m² it's 18.3%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(71 m² median across 8 EPCs).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 75% of similar EPCs). Last changed hands 11 years ago, in December 2014.
